ABSTRACT

Tissue homeostasis is maintained by tight control of signaling events regulating cell survival and cell death. Natural products such as resveratrol have gained considerable attention as cancer chemopreventive or cardioprotective agents and also because of their antitumor properties. The identification of naturally occurring antioxidant compounds such as resveratrol as signal transduction inhibitors of cell survival pathways may open new perspectives for their use in the treatment of a variety of human disorders. Apoptosis or programmed cell death is the cell’s intrinsic death program that occurs in various physiological and pathological situations. The phosphoinositide 3-kinase/AKT pathway is a potent mediator of cell survival signals such as those delivered by growth factors or interactions with neighboring cells or with the extracellular matrix. The transcription factor nuclear factor-kappaB plays an important role in tumor formation and progression. Principally, tumor cells may acquire resistance through upregulation of antiapoptotic mechanisms or by downregulation of proapoptotic signaling molecules.
